The de Havilland DH.98 Mosquito is a twin-engine, multi-role combat plane that was introduced by the British during the Second World War.

The “Mossie,” was an incredibly light and nimble fighter bomber that was primarily made out of wood, eventually becoming one of the most iconic planes of the RAF to ever take the skies. 

YouTube / Fight to Fly Photography

This footage features the DH.98 Mosquito T.Mk.III. in a nighttime engine run event held by the Flying Heritage and Combat Armor Museum last December 2017.

Another interesting fact is that currently, there are only four of these birds in the world that are deemed airworthy. Pretty amazing right?
